Description

The Management Accountant is a critical role that provides financial insights and analysis to support our business in making informed decisions to help achieve its financial goals. This financial guidance helps to improve on decision-marking, enhances operational efficiency and drives company profitability.

On a typical day, it looks like this:

  • Analysing daily transactions, ensuring they align with the budget and checking for discrepancies or errors
  • Creating financial reports, such as profit and loss statements or cash flow forecasts, for senior management and leaders
  • Liaising with key stakeholders, along with colleagues and senior managers in the Finance team to gather data, understand operational needs, and provide financial insights to support decision making
  • Review cost structures, identifying areas to reduce expenses and ensuring departmental spending is within budget
  • Updating financial forecasts based on current business performance and helping with the preparation of future budgets
  • Investigating variances between actual and expected financial performance and providing recommendations for corrective actions.
  • Manage end to end finance and accounting activities - bank reconciliation, journal entry, AP, AR, GL, employee claims, fixed asset, expenses, liabilities and revenue
  • Financial reporting and analysis
  • Prepare and submit monthly financial statement and ensure compliance with local statutory requirements
  • Prepare variance analysis and financial insights report and submit to UK Finance
  • Participate and oversee in financial audits and annual budgeting process
  • Review transfer pricing agreements
  • Manage inter-company collection and payments
  • Handling corporate tax computation for CP204
  • Manage payroll and statutory payment for clients (MPS-half and EMS)
  • Updating company information for company sectary related to company finance
  • Update company information changes to bank and statutory bodies (Kastam, LHDN)
  • Participate in integration process
  • Checking of salary report and verifying bank file before requesting for approval (Alliance Bank and HSBC)
  • Checking of EPF, Income Tax, SOSCO, EIS, HRDC, ZAKAT payment report and verifying the bank file before requesting for approval
  • Work with external partners such as auditors, bank, tax consultant and company secretary to ensure regulatory compliance
